Arnold Ventures (AV) is a philanthropy that supports research to understand the root causes of Americas most persistent and pressing problems as well as evidence-based solutions to address them. By focusing on systemic change AV is working to improve the lives of American families strengthen their communities and promote their economic opportunity. Since Laura and John Arnold launched their foundation in 2008 the philanthropy has expanded and AVs focus areas include education criminal justice health infrastructure and public finance advocating for bipartisan policy reforms that will lead to lasting scalable change. The Arnolds became signatories of the Giving Pledge in 2010.
Position Overview
AV is building out a mission-aligned investing team that will invest across the organizations focus areas. The team will have a broad mandate to further the philanthropic goals of the organization with discretion to invest across the capital structure (debt through equity) as a limited partner in funds and via credit enhancements and guarantees. The team will develop and invest in opportunities where market-rate and concessionary capital can catalyze private and public sector investment. Investments will be made from a $5 billion endowment. This is a highly entrepreneurial opportunity to be on the ground floor of shaping an investment platform with substantial flexibility and resources to maximize impact for millions of Americans.
The role may be structured as a generalist who invests across AVs focus areas or a specialist who focuses on a high-priority investment area. This position is located in AVs New York City office and reports to the Executive Vice President Mission-Aligned Investments.
Core Responsibilities
Work on deal teams that include programmatic investment and legal colleagues to execute new investments including thesis formation sourcing initial evaluation investment shaping with company executives and co-investors structuring due diligence and financial modeling and negotiation of legal documentation
Partner closely with programmatic colleagues to understand the evidence base policy landscape and philanthropic goals in critical investment areas
Present investments to AVs Board of Directors
Manage portfolio investments including relevant board observer responsibilities
